Saint-Martin’s church

Saint-Martin’s church is one of three churches with this name in Arlon. It was built between 1907 and 1914. Its tower stands at an impressive 97 m high and its silhouette can be seen from afar in the Arlon landscape. The church has been a listed monument since 2002.

The rose window and stained glass

When you visit this monument, be sure to admire the magnificent rose window and the “Matin de Pâques” [Easter morning] stained glass window.
